The CCBL announces that the 2023 CCBL Championship Game will be held at Harmon Stadium/Dusty Rhodes Field at the University of North Florida on Wednesday July 26 at 6:30 pm. The ceremonial first pitch will be performed by the recently hired Head Baseball Coach Joe Mercadante.

As a former pitching coach for 2 MLB organizations, we keep in mind the greater good (college fall season in particular) with monitoring innings pitched in the summer. Our feeling is, if you come to our league healthy, we want you to go home healthy.

First game of the day in the books at JP Small. Sharks victorious over the Hawks 9-7. Five home runs hit in today’s contest: Sharks’ Alex Ogletree and Bobby Pollock (grand slam). Hawks’ Ethan Martini and John Lanier (2 home runs for John). Hyeonho Cho with the complete game win.
